- [ ] **Step 7: Breaker override escrow.** After sealing the signing keys for the Tallgrove upstream API circuit breaker, confirm the support team can force the breaker open during a full outage. The override bundle lives in the sealed escrow drawer and is useless without its unlock phrase. Two ceremony witnesses must initial this step before proceeding. The escrow bundle is decrypted with the recovery passphrase that follows.

vault phrase of kahip-kahop = holath-quenmir

## Authentication

Quick note for review: the Tidebarrel partner SFTP drop doesn't use keys anymore — files land in the inbox and our poller fetches them over the internal gateway API instead. That gateway wants a bearer header on every poll request. For the review environment, authenticate with the token below.

portal login ticket: eyJhbGciOiJIUzI1NiIsInR5cCI6IkpXVCJ9.eyJzdWIiOiIwEOsktwVNwIn0.-UJU3fdyyCgG

Subject: Quickstore 4.2 — bloom filter now fronts the KV layer

Plugin authors: starting with this release, Quickstore places a bloom filter ahead of the key-value store. Negative lookups return faster; false positives fall through safely. No API changes are required on your side. Verify your plugin against the staging build referenced below.

session token of fahif-tadup = htk3_9c7

Handover Note — Loyalty Programme Overhaul

From Director Maren Kolbe to Director Ivo Trask, for board awareness. The Lumora Rewards redesign is at stage two: tier structures approved, points-migration modelling complete, and the Fenwick pilot scheduled for spring. Outstanding items are the redemption-cost cap and legal sign-off on the revised terms. Budget remains within the approved envelope. Ivo assumes ownership from Monday. The confidential note on strategic intent appears directly below.

internal memo for kawip-hadug: Headcount on the Wenwyn team goes from 7 to 140 by the end of January. Gross margin on Wenwyn came in at 20 percent against a plan of 15 percent.